idleship

/ˈaɪdəlʃɪp/

Definitions

1. noun

The state or quality of being idle or inactive; idleness.

“His idleship during the summer led to a significant decline in his productivity.”

2. noun

A period of time during which someone is idle or inactive.

“Her idleship during the winter break was filled with reading and traveling.”
